Article Overview

This article is a coding Q&A focused on radiology documentation for knee x-rays in an emergency department setting. It explains why the documentation record matters for claim support, how incomplete wording can affect billing review, and why provider documentation should clearly reflect the imaging performed. The piece is aimed at billing staff, coders, and clinicians who document or review diagnostic imaging services.

Why This Topic Matters

Clear imaging documentation helps support claim accuracy and reduces the risk of audit adjustments or refunds. The article highlights why radiology records must align with what is billed and why staff should reinforce thorough provider documentation.
